Questions & Answers

What companies run services between Naperville, IL, USA and Chicago Loop, IL, USA?

Metra operates a train from Naperville to Chicago Union Station hourly. Tickets cost $5–6 and the journey takes 1h 4m.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Washington St & Ogden Ave to Washington & Lasalle via Yorktown Center, 54th/Cermak Pink Line Station, and Cicero & 24th Place Terminal in around 3h 3m.
